Chapter 1
Physical science
• Science – gathering knowledge about the
  natural world
• Physical science – study of matter and
  energy (matter – “stuff” everything is made
  of / energy – ability to do work)
• Chemistry – study of all forms of matter
• Physics – study of the way energy affects
  matter
• Science is all around you: meteorology,
  geology, biology
• Scientific method – 6 steps used to
  answer questions and solve problems
• 1. ask a question – be specific (only 1 ?)
• 2. form hypothesis – make educated
  guess
• Test hypothesis – do the experiment

• Control – nothing changes, used for
  comparison
• Dependent variable – what is being
  changed
• Independent variable – what is used to
  make the change
• 4. analyze results – does the results
  prove or disprove your hypothesis
• 5. draw conclusion – sum up the results
• 6. communicate the results – write paper,
  make presentation, create website
• Models – represent object or system
• 3 types:
  – Physical – a three dimensional representation
    of an object (a globe), doesn’t act or interact
    like the real thing
  – Mathematical – equations or data (E=mc2)
  – Conceptual – system of ideas (big bang
    theory)
Law’s and Theories
• Law- summary of many experimental
  results and observations – tells how
  things work…not why it works
• Theory – an explanation for many
  hypothesis and observations
